Hi,
ich stehe mal wieder vor einem kleinem Problem:
Und zwar erstelle ich ein TXiPanel Objekt (XiControls) und
setze da ein TImage rein und lade ein Jpeg Bild.
Ich sehe dann zwar das Panel, aber kein Image darauf.
Ich habe dann mal mit WinSpy geguckt und habe auch kein Image im
Panel gefunden.
Vielleicht wisst ihr ja ne Lösung
Vielleicht findet ja von euch einer den Fehler....
Delphi-Quellcode:
procedure addImage(pan: TXiPanel; img: TImage; filename: string);
begin
img := TImage.Create(pan);
//img.Align := alClient;
img.Top := 0;
img.Left := 0;
img.Width := 100;
img.Height := 100;
img.Stretch := true;
img.Picture.LoadFromFile(filename);
img.Visible := true;
img.Parent := pan;
end;
ich hab's auch mal mit TImage.repaint versucht, aber später hab ich ja festgestellt, dass wohl kein image im
Panel eingeschachtelt ist.
(Und die
Unit "JPEG" hab ich auch eingebunden)
Grüße,
Björn
EDIT: Das Problem lag hier:
addImage(var pan: TXiPanel....